Matthew 6:31 - The Emphatic Diaglott New Testament (1942)

31 Not therefore you may be over careful, saying: What may we eat, or what may we drink, or what may we put on?

King James Version (Oxford) 1769

31 Therefore take no thought, saying, What shall we eat? or, What shall we drink? or, Wherewithal shall we be clothed?

Amplified Bible - Classic Edition

31 Therefore do not worry and be anxious, saying, What are we going to have to eat? or, What are we going to have to drink? or, What are we going to have to wear?

American Standard Version (1901)

31 Be not therefore anxious, saying, What shall we eat? or, What shall we drink? or, Wherewithal shall we be clothed?

Common English Bible

31 Therefore, don’t worry and say, ‘What are we going to eat?’ or ‘What are we going to drink?’ or ‘What are we going to wear?’

Catholic Public Domain Version

31 Therefore, do not choose to be anxious, saying: 'What shall we eat, and what shall we drink, and with what shall we be clothed?'
